English: Press photograph, with grey gouache highlights, of the first nuclear test on the Australian mainland, Totem 1, which was carried out at Emu Field in the Great Victoria Desert, north-western South Australia on 15 October 1953. Verso with wet stamps dated OCT 19 1953, and pastedown newspaper clipping (from an American newspaper): 'ATOMIC CLOUD: In South Australia - A cloud formed over the Woomera rocket range after a recent atomic test conducted by British scientists. - A.P. wirephoto
